Short answer is: everywhere. I buy charms from many sources; some wholesale pewter vendors, some from eBay. Occasionally a few from Etsy, but only if I can’t find that exact charm elsewhere. I have no problem supporting Etsy sellers, but they tend to sell charms in low volume at higher prices than the wholesale places. Whenever I design a charm bracelet, I look for the exact right version of the charm I want, rather than the cheapest/easiest to get one. So as a result, my Harry Potter bracelets have owls that look just like Hedwig, rather than a generic 70’s looking owl.
